La Broquerie, MB Local Guide
How much does it cost to rent an apartment in La Broquerie?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| La Broquerie Studio Apartments | $1,111 | $839 | $1,550 |
| La Broquerie 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,681 | $873 | $3,410 |
| La Broquerie 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,023 | $1,101 | $6,614 |
| La Broquerie 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,402 | $1,799 | $4,320 |

Largest Available La Broquerie and Nearby 1 Bedroom Apartments
The largest available 1 Bedroom apartment unit in La Broquerie, MB is found at Parkwood Square and is 1,060 square feet priced from $1,175. The Zü Apartments has the second largest 1 Bedroom, which is sized at 950 square feet and currently listed start at $2,000. Here is today’s list of the largest available 1 Bedroom units in La Broquerie:
| Apartment Listing | Model Name | Square Footage | Priced From |
|---|---|---|---|
| Parkwood Square | 1 Bed 1 Bath | 1,060 Sq Ft | $1,175 |
| The Zü Apartments | Queen | 950 Sq Ft | $2,000 |
| 300 Main | Floor Plan J | 929 Sq Ft | $2,368 |
| Latitude 49 at Sage Creek | 1 Bedroom, 2 Bathroom + Den | 881 Sq Ft | $1,922 |
| Bison Pointe | 869 Sq Ft | $1,690 | |
| Palmer House | One bed | 850 Sq Ft | $1,399 |
| The Summit at Seasons | 1 Bedroom, 2 Bathroom + Den | 830 Sq Ft | $1,953 |
| The Boardwalk | Levine v. D | 776 Sq Ft | $1,606 |
| One Eighty Roslyn | 1 Bedroom, 1 Bath | 771 Sq Ft | $1,492 |
| The Arts Residences | 1 Bedroom(s) and 1 Bathroom(s) | 762 Sq Ft | $1,595 |
